Создайте изображение с помощью Stream в Aspose.PSD для Java

Введение

В области разработки Java Aspose.PSD выделяется как надежная библиотека для обработки изображений. Одной из его мощных функций является возможность создавать изображения с использованием потоков, что обеспечивает гибкость и эффективность обработки данных изображений. Это руководство проведет вас через процесс создания изображений с использованием потока в Aspose.PSD для Java, предоставляя практический опыт с пошаговыми инструкциями.

Предварительные условия

Прежде чем приступить к изучению руководства, убедитесь, что у вас есть следующие предварительные условия:

  • Комплект разработки Java (JDK): убедитесь, что в вашей системе установлена Java.
  • Библиотека Aspose.PSD: Загрузите и настройте библиотеку Aspose.PSD для Java. Необходимые ресурсы вы можете найти в документация .
  • Интегрированная среда разработки (IDE): выберите Java-совместимую среду разработки, например Eclipse или IntelliJ IDEA, для беспрепятственного опыта разработки.

Импортировать пакеты

Начните с импорта необходимых пакетов в ваш проект Java. Включите библиотеку Aspose.PSD, чтобы использовать ее функциональные возможности в своем коде. Вот базовый пример:

import com.aspose.psd.Image;

import com.aspose.psd.imageoptions.BmpOptions;
import com.aspose.psd.sources.FileCreateSource;
import com.aspose.psd.sources.StreamSource;
import com.aspose.psd.system.io.FileMode;
import com.aspose.psd.system.io.FileStream;
import com.aspose.psd.system.io.Stream;
import java.io.FileInputStream;

Шаг 1. Настройка каталога документов

String dataDir = "Your Document Directory";

Обязательно замените"Your Document Directory" с фактическим путем к каталогу вашего документа.

Шаг 2. Укажите имя выходного файла

String desName = dataDir + "CreatingImageUsingStream_out.bmp";

Определите желаемое имя для выходного файла изображения.

Шаг 3. Настройте параметры BmpOptions.

BmpOptions imageOptions = new BmpOptions();
imageOptions.setBitsPerPixel(24);

Создайте экземплярBmpOptions и настройте его свойства, такие как количество бит на пиксель.

Шаг 4. Создайте FileCreateSource

FileCreateSource stream = new FileCreateSource(dataDir + "sample_out.bmp");
imageOptions.setSource(stream);

Создать экземплярFileCreateSource используя каталог данных, и установите его в качестве источника дляBmpOptions.

Шаг 5: Создать изображение

Image image = Image.create(imageOptions, 500, 500);

Создайте экземплярImage путем вызоваcreate метод, передавая настроенныйBmpOptions и указание размеров изображения.

Шаг 6: Обработка изображения

// Выполните необходимые операции обработки изображений
// ...

// Сохраняем обработанное изображение
image.save(desName);

Выполните все необходимые операции по обработке изображения и сохраните полученное изображение, используя командуsave метод.

Заключение

Поздравляем! Вы успешно научились создавать изображения с использованием потока в Aspose.PSD для Java. В этом руководстве описаны основные шаги: от импорта пакетов до окончательной обработки и сохранения изображения. Поэкспериментируйте с различными настройками и изучите дополнительные функции, которые расширят ваши возможности создания изображений.

Часто задаваемые вопросы

Вопрос 1: Могу ли я использовать Aspose.PSD с другими библиотеками Java?

О1: Да, Aspose.PSD предназначен для полной интеграции с другими библиотеками Java, обеспечивая универсальность ваших проектов.

Вопрос 2. Где я могу найти поддержку для запросов, связанных с Aspose.PSD?

A2: Посетите Форум Aspose.PSD за поддержку сообщества и обсуждения.

Вопрос 3: Существует ли бесплатная пробная версия Aspose.PSD?

О3: Да, вы можете получить доступ к бесплатной пробной версии. здесь .

Вопрос 4: Как получить временную лицензию на Aspose.PSD?

A4: Получите временную лицензию здесь .

В5: Каковы системные требования для Aspose.PSD?

A5: См. документация подробные системные требования.